about

A Mawwaal is a vocal improvisation on a poem in colloquial Arabic.

Nomadica Toronto, Ontario

NOMADICA re-imagines and recombines the rich, soulful and righteously celebratory musics of the Arabs, Gypsies and Jews. Led by Juno-award winning trumpeter and composer, David Buchbinder and vocalist, multi-instrumentalist and dancer, Roula Said, the band features soaring vocals, a front line of masterful improvisors and a heavily funky rhythm section.
